Meaning
斗牛 literally means 'to fight a bull' and primarily refers to the Spanish tradition of bullfighting. In modern Chinese usage, it can also refer to a popular card game sometimes called 'Bull Bull' or 'Niu Niu,' though that game is more commonly written as 牛牛.
Usage
When discussing the Spanish sport, 斗牛 is the standard term. The word can be used as a noun (the event/sport) or as a verb (the act of fighting bulls). In mainland China, bullfighting is not a common cultural practice, so the term is mostly encountered in discussions of Spanish or Latin American culture, or in reference to card games.
Examples
- 01西班牙的斗牛是一项传统体育活动。.Spanish bullfighting is a traditional sport.
- 02他从小就梦想成为一名斗牛士。.He has dreamed of becoming a bullfighter since he was young.

Common collocations
- 斗牛士bullfighter, matador
- 斗牛场bullring
- 西班牙斗牛Spanish bullfighting
Origin
The term combines 斗 (to fight) with 牛 (bull/ox), creating a straightforward compound that directly describes the activity. It's a calque from Western languages describing the Spanish tradition.
